Is it OK to add milk to tomato soup?
Yes, you can add milk to tomato soup for a super-creamy spin. However because tomatoes are acidic, there’s a chance that the milk can curdle. To avoid this, add a half teaspoon of baking soda to the soup. The baking soda neutralizes the acidity of the tomatoes, which prevents milk from curdling—and can improve the taste, too.

Can a person on dialysis eat raw tomatoes?
Especially for dialysis patients, every morsel of moist food, as well as any beverages, counts towards your fluid intake. Tomatoes have a very high water content. Raw, cooked, or especially in sauce, tomatoes are to be avoided for fluid restrictive renal diets.
Will lentils raise blood sugar?
Yes, anything with a notable amount of carbohydrates in them will cause your blood glucose levels to rise. Lentils aren’t a special exception. So beans, quinoa, oats, bananas, sweet potatoes, will all increase your blood glucose levels at least temporarily, because they are mainly carbohydrates.

Can diabetics eat yellow squash?
Yellow squash can fit into your diet for diabetes because it is fat-free. Eat your squash raw or steam, grill or roast it to keep it fat-free. If you saute it or brush it with fat before roasting it, use vegetable oil or olive oil instead of butter, which is high in saturated fat.
Should a diabetic eat lettuce?
Dieters often eat plenty of lettuce because it fills you up and provides essential nutrients, such as folate and vitamins A and K, without providing a lot of calories. Likewise, other nonstarchy vegetables, including lettuce, can be a good choice for diabetics due to their low carbohydrate content and minimal effects on blood sugar levels.
